About Campo Arenal Airport

Campo Arenal Airport (SA11) is located in Campo Arenal, AR at an elevation of 7,622 feet MSL, making density altitude a consideration for performance planning. The airport has 1 runway (6/24), with the longest at 6,348 feet.

Airport Overview

Campo Arenal Airport serves Campo Arenal in AR. As a smaller airfield, services may be limited. Pilots should verify fuel availability and operating hours before arrival. The airport features 1 runway (6/24) with asp surface. The longest runway measures 6,348 feet, accommodating most general aviation and regional aircraft.

Elevation Considerations

At 7622 feet MSL, density altitude is an important consideration for flight planning, particularly during summer months. Performance calculations should account for the reduced air density at this elevation.
